What Is the Infrared Sauna Price in India?
For a well-built one or two-person far infrared sauna made for home use, prices may generally fall between approximately ?2,20,000 and ?2,70,000, depending on the specifications and configuration. Installation, delivery and usage guidance may be provided with models supplied by professional providers, although buyers should check exactly what is covered before purchasing.
Bigger cabins designed for more people naturally require additional materials, additional heaters and higher electrical capacity. Commercial sauna installations may also require different dimensions, finishes and features because they are expected to handle heavier usage. Consequently, judging two sauna cabins only by their advertised price can be inaccurate when their construction, heating systems and service arrangements are significantly different.
How Cabin Size and Seating Capacity Affect Cost
Cabin size are among the clearest factors affecting the cost of an infrared sauna in India. A smaller one or two-person cabin requires less timber, fewer heating elements and a smaller overall installation area than a larger model designed for families or commercial users.
A compact cabin can be well suited for a bathroom extension, dedicated wellness room, terrace enclosure or home gym where space is limited. Larger cabins may be more suitable for fitness centres, spas and wellness centres that need to serve multiple users. Before choosing a model, buyers should measure the proposed installation area and review access, airflow and electrical arrangements as well as the size of the cabin itself.

Local Manufacturing Versus Imported Saunas
Manufacturing location can also influence the Infrared Sauna Price in India. Imported units may involve shipping, customs duties and extra logistics costs. Spare parts and servicing can also become significant factors after the original purchase.
Locally manufactured systems can offer practical advantages when installation support, spare parts or technical servicing are required. Buyers should therefore investigate the complete ownership experience rather than looking only on the cheapest purchase cost. A sauna that has readily available servicing and appropriate spare parts may offer better long-term value than a cheaper unit with poor after-sales assistance.

Daily Electricity and Operating Costs
The initial purchase cost is only a single part of sauna ownership. Running costs should also be evaluated, particularly when the cabin will be used regularly. A standard home infrared sauna can operate using a typical 16-amp power connection, although the exact electrical specifications should always be verified for the selected model and installation.
A typical 30–40 minute session may consume approximately two units of electricity. At an indicative electricity rate of ?9 per unit, this would represent an operating cost of approximately ?18 per session. Real-world expenditure will change according to heater capacity, session duration, electricity rates in the area and frequency of use.
Infrared systems can also have relatively short warm-up periods, often around 10–15 minutes depending Infrared Sauna Price in India on the specific model and ambient conditions. This can decrease the amount of time energy is required before the sauna is ready for use.
Sauna Maintenance and Long-Term Value
Another point when evaluating the infrared sauna purchase price is maintenance. Unlike steam systems, infrared cabins do not normally rely on boilers, storage tanks or a continuous water supply for heat generation. This can reduce the complexity of day-to-day care and limit the number of plumbing-related parts requiring attention.
Everyday care generally involves ensuring internal surfaces remain clean and dry and observing the manufacturer's operating instructions. Electrical systems and heating elements should be examined and maintained by properly trained technicians whenever needed. Buyers should also review warranty conditions, spare-part availability and after-sales support because these factors can influence long-term ownership costs.
Infrared Sauna Compared with a Steam Bath
Infrared and steam systems create different wellness environments. A steam bath warms the surrounding environment using heated water vapour, while an infrared sauna uses infrared heating elements within a dry cabin. This variation affects installation requirements, warm-up time, humidity, maintenance and energy consumption.
Traditional steam baths generally require plumbing, drainage and suitable water-heating equipment. Infrared sauna cabins can be simpler to install where adequate electrical power is already available. For buyers mainly concerned with ongoing operating requirements, this more straightforward setup can make infrared systems appealing. The right choice ultimately depends on individual preferences, available space, expected use and budget.
